There’s also
!!, which is handy when you type a command that requires sudo, you can just dosudo !!to repeat the last command withsudoprefixed.Also, if you know
emacsshortcuts (ctrl-a,ctrl-e,ctrl-l, etc), you know bash shortcuts, and the other way around - you can also replace those with vim shortcuts, but I don’t like that. It breaks my brain, even though I like vim.
